Limbs: limbs grow outward from body wall somatopleure as limb buds. bone, cartilage, and connective tissue of the limb arise from somatic mesoderm of the limb bud. dermis and skeletal muscle come from dermatome and myotome migrations into the limb. Joints are classified by the type of movement they allow and the shapes of their parts: ball and socket joints, found in the shoulders and hips, allow for movement in almost all directions. hinge joints, found in elbows and knees, allow for movement in one direction.
